After flying high against York on Tuesday, Lakeview came back down to earth. The Vikings came up short against the Skutt Catholic SkyHawks on Thursday, falling 3-0. For those keeping track at home, that's the biggest loss the Vikings have suffered since October 1, 2024.
The match finished with set scores of 25-17, 25-19, 25-13.
Lakeview's loss came despite strong showings from Kenzie Greisen and Rallie Boyer. Greisen had 12 digs and one assist, while Boyer had ten digs. Grace Dawson also deserves some recognition as she had her first block of the season.
Skutt Catholic's success was the result of a balanced attack that saw several players step up, but Mia Stevens led the charge by getting 20 assists and seven digs. Stevens is on a roll when it comes to assists, as she's now posted 13 or more in each of the last five games she's played. Maggie McMahon was another key player, getting six digs and two aces.
Lakeview's defeat dropped their record down to 6-2. As for Skutt Catholic, they pushed their record up to 8-2 with the victory, which was their fifth straight at home dating back to last season.
Lakeview wasted no time getting back out on the court and has already played their next contest, a 2-0 win against Central City on the 13th. As for Skutt Catholic, they will challenge South Sioux City at 6:00 p.m. on Tuesday.
